Transaction 59b83b76c47077b07d172002fd05528bc20d151a26f442311c6c40397111ba2a
1 Input
1 Output
-
59b83b76c47077b07d172002fd05528bc20d151a26f442311c6c40397111ba2a:0
- value
- 330759
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9fad3aed3cbc91a4553198bd740907162d39972d OP_EQUAL
- address
- 3GFJtHi31WwC9fFY137bWcP1m7WzHKgxZS